Amnesty’s various regional offices are being asked to study whether to end the group’s official “neutral” stance on abortion. In its place, the group could declare access to abortion a human right in specific cases includ ing rape and life-threatening pregnancy complications. The proposals — growir^ out of Amnesty’s campaign to stop violence against women — also include wheUier to sup port legal access to contracep tion. Few places, including the United States, appear ready for an u^p or down vote on the matter. Instead, the discus sions so far have been gener al, noncommittal arid pas sionate. In New Zealand, Amnesty’s local director, Ced Simpson, said there have been “strongly held views on both sides of the debate.” A final decision could come at Amnesty’s next interna tional gatiiming - in Mexico in August 2007. But the Amnesty statement said “much dep^ids on the out comes” of the current debates in various countries. If there’s agreement that the abortion rightfl proposal has support, it could either be adopted by consensus or put to a formal vote. Otherwise, it could be dropped or sent back for more discussions.
